Through flashbacks, it is revealed that on the day before he died, Wes met with Laurel's mother, Sandrine Castillo . Sandrine feared Wes would go to the police and jeopardize the public offering of her husband’s company, Antares. She subsequently called Jorge Castillo, leading to the hit on Wes. Thanks to Count Zero/CyberpunX/SCS*TRC for providing Turbo Assembler v7.2!

This version is another in the series of Turbo mods developed by Black/Angels and in fact we hadn't seen this version referenced anywhere else until now. This makes the 107th version of Turbo Assembler to be found. Thank you Count Zero!
